Transaction

95e340028bf30bf122205ebdba1f41fa400ecc8fda37d9e0fef5017fc0715efb
308,367 confirmations
Timestamp
1588087761
Block628,015
Fee14,448 sats
Fee rate21 sats/vB
view on mempool.space

Inputs & Outputs